景弋 陳航(上海核工程研究設計院 上海 200233)
?
核電站無線通信系統QoS機制的研究
景弋陳航
(上海核工程研究設計院上海200233)
摘要近年來隨著核電技術、無線通信技術、EMC技術的發展,基于WLAN的無線通信技術已經在核電站得到了越來越廣泛的應用。VoWLAN(Voice over WLAN)是一種利用WLAN來傳輸VoIP(Voice over Internet Protocol)幀的技術,VoWLAN技術是對VoIP的擴展和更新,將VoIP無線化,使用戶能更方便更直接地進行語音通信,這也使VoWLAN技術在核電站得到了普遍應用,而Qos (Quality of Service)則為網絡通信建立一個有保證的傳輸系統。本文介紹了VoWLAN的關鍵技術及影響VoWLAN的Qos的主要原因,闡述了時延、抖動、丟包等影響QoS的機理和改進方法。
關鍵詞VoIPWLANQoSSIP
伴隨核電技術的更新換代,應用在核電站的無線通信新技術也在快速發展。近年來,隨著中國核電進入第三代核電建設發展期,低功耗、高兼容性、部署容易、基于IEEE802.11系列標準的WLAN技術在核電站的應用也得到了快速發展,同時其所運用的基于SIP協議的VoWLAN技術也在核電站無線通信系統中得到了推廣,并在核電廠建造、調試、運行等各個不同時期都起到了便利的作用。
眾所周知VoIP是一種利用IP網絡傳輸語音的技術,是語音通信和網絡通信緊密融合的技術,而VoWLAN則是一種基于WLAN網絡傳輸的語音通信技術。從某種程度上講,VoWLAN技術是對VoIP的擴展和更新,將VoIP無線化,使用戶能更方便更直接地進行語音通信。隨著網絡技術的飛速發展和多媒體應用技術的深入和普及,在IP網絡上基于SIP應用的語音通信VoIP已成為技術發展的必然趨勢。然而,如何能在實時語音的傳輸中保障良好的QoS 是VoWLAN技術在核電站深入應用和持續發展的關鍵。
1、VoIP
VoIP簡而言之就是將模擬信號(Voice)數字化,以數據封包(Data Packet)的形式在IP網絡(IP Network)上做實時傳遞。VoIP最大的優勢是能廣泛地采用IP互連的環境,提供比傳統業務更多、更好的服務。VoIP可以在IP網絡上方便的傳送語音、視頻和數據等業務,為核電站無線通信系統的拓展服務預留了空間。
但是IP網絡主要是用來傳輸數據業務,采用的是盡力而為的、無連接的技術,因此缺少服務質量保證,存在分組丟失、失序到達和時延抖動等情況。數據業務對此要求不高,但話音屬于實時業務,對時序、時延等有嚴格的要求。因而,如何能在實時語音的傳輸中保障良好的QoS是VoIP技術發展的關鍵[1],同時也是VoIP技術在核電站應用的關鍵。
2、WLAN
WLAN是相當便利的數據傳輸系統,它利用射頻的技術,使用無線電磁波,取代雙絞銅線所構成的局域網絡,在空中進行通信連接,使得使用人員得以擺脫有線電纜的束縛。
WLAN的實現協議有很多,其中最為著名也是應用最為廣泛的當屬Wi-Fi,它實際上提供了一種能夠將各種終端都使用無線進行互聯的技術,為用戶屏蔽了各種終端之間的差異性。基于IEEE802.11系列標準的無線局域網允許在局域網絡環境中使用可以不必授權的ISM頻段中的2.4GHz或5GHz射頻波段進行無線連接[2]。
目前應用最為廣泛的WLAN的主要標準協議如下:
(1)IEEE802.11g,2003年,物理層補充(54Mbit/s,工作在2.4GHz);
(2)IEEE 802.11n,2009年9月通過正式標準,WLAN的傳輸速率由802.11a及802.11g提供的54Mbps、108Mbps,提高達350Mbps甚至高達475Mbps;
(3)IEEE 802.11ac,802.11n之后的版本。工作在5G頻段,理論上可以提供高達每秒1Gbit的數據傳輸能力。
3、SIP
SIP(Session Initiation Protocol,會話初始協議)是由IETF (Internet Engineering Task Force,因特網工程任務組)制定的多媒體通信協議。它是一個基于文本的應用層控制協議,用于創建、修改和釋放一個或多個參與者的會話。廣泛應用于CS(Circuit Switched,電路交換)、NGN(Next Generation Network,下一代網絡)以及IMS(IP Multimedia Subsystem,IP多媒體子系統)的網絡中,可以支持并應用于語音、視頻、數據等多媒體業務,同時也可以應用于Presence(呈現)、Instant Message(即時消息)等特色業務[4]。另外SIP協議還充分考慮了對傳統公共電話網絡的各種業務,可以與其他用于建立呼叫的信令系統或協議結合使用。例如一個SIP主叫可以識別出PSTN上的被叫及其電話號碼,通過與PSTN相連的網關向被叫發起并建立呼叫。這便使核電站的無線通信系統可以通過SIP協議與其他有線通信系統之間實現互聯互通,比如自動電話系統、呼叫通話系統等。可以說,SIP協議是核電站無線語音通信和業務拓展實現的基礎。
QoS被定義為:保證在維護特定的連接質量、延時、抖動參數的情況下,提供能夠滿足業務傳輸所需帶寬的能力。一般來說,QoS需求是人們對話音、視頻、其他多媒體流等實時業務的感性認識,通常是一種端到端概念,網絡中的任何瓶頸都會影響服務質量[5]。
1、語音質量評價
語音質量的測量方式是憑主觀感知的,采用MOS (Mean Opinion Score)方法評價語音質量,評測方法在ITU-TP.800中定義,如表1所示。

表1 MOS值的定義
MOS評價具有一定的主觀性,但作為參考評價方法,核電站的無線通信系統作為核電站的重要通信方式設計上考慮的MOS值應能達到4.0以上。
2、帶寬
帶寬是指在網絡上傳輸任何業務信息時每秒所能傳輸的字節數。一般認為,帶寬越大越有利于數據業務的傳輸,但任何傳輸介質的帶寬都是有限的[3]。
3、時延
時延是接收到的數據包與發送數據包的時間差。時延又分為算法時延、處理時延、網絡傳輸時延和抖動緩沖時延。
4、丟包
丟包率定義為在網絡傳輸數據包時丟棄數據包的最高比率。丟包率應小于5%,當丟包率超過10%時將極大影響服務質量。丟包的原因:線路誤碼或網絡路由故障;傳輸時延過長或網絡擁塞導致分組被丟棄。
5、抖動
抖動也叫時延變化,是指由于各種延時的變化導致網絡中的數據分組到達速率的變化。如果網絡抖動比較嚴重,那么有的話音包會因遲到而被丟棄,會產生話音的斷續及部分失真,嚴重影響音質。延遲的變化應該在10%以內為好。
抖動原因:排隊時延;可變的分組大小;中間鏈路和路由器上的相對負載。
6、包亂序
當網絡較差的時候,語音包在傳輸過程中很容易出現亂序現象,從而影響接收端播放。但是根據每個語音包的時間戳(Time Stamp),可以方便地判斷出語音包的發送順序,通常采用的解決方法同樣是在接收端使用抖動緩存,對失序包進行調整,從而重現發端的順序。
1、VoIP的QoS機制
VoIP利用IP網絡承載語音,即語音和數據將共享傳輸帶寬,在此環境下如何提供語音等實時業務的QoS控制是一個不容忽視的部分。其中,多媒體語音交換使用的SIP本身屬于上層協議,而利用上層協議提供實時業務必須得到物理層和MAC層的支持,它要求MAC層能提供可靠的分組傳輸,傳輸時延低且抖動小[6]。通常實現QoS的方法有兩種:
(1)基于資源預留
網絡資源按照某個業務的QoS要求進行分配,制定資源管理策略。IETF提出的綜合服務[IntServ,RFC1633]體系結構便是基于這種策略,資源預留協議[RSVP,RFC2205]是其核心部分。根據RSVP的預留資源占所有資源的比例,Intserv模型定義了幾種服務類型:
①有保障的服務[RFC 2212]。對帶寬、時延及分組丟失率提供定量的要求和質量保證措施,如VolP應用建議可以預留10M帶寬和小于1s的時延;
②可控負載服務[RFC2211]:在網絡負荷較大的情況下所能夠提供的近似于沒有過載時的服務;
③盡力而為的服務。和當前互聯網向多數用戶提供的服務機制類似,沒有任何可以控制的質量保證。
(2)基于優先級
網絡邊界節點對業務流進行分類、整形和標記。核心節點按照資源管理策略分配資源,對QoS要求高的業務給以優先處理。IETF提出的區分服務[DiffServ,RFC 2475]便是基于這種策略,它取代了IP服務類型字段(TOS)改名為DS,并用它承載IP包服務所要求的信息,是嚴格意義上的三層技術,不涉及低層的傳輸技術。
Intserv模型中的RSVP可為數據流提供良好帶寬保證,而DiffServ則不需要信令,在發送報文前,不需要通知路由器,網絡也不必為每個流維護狀態,它只根據報文中規定的QoS來提供特定的服務。并且,它不像Intserv那樣對每個流都進行QoS控制,而是對流聚合后的每一類進行QoS控制,它只是對數據流簡單加標記進行優先級分類。從對路由器的要求來說,RSVP比DiffServ更復雜,因此RSVP不適用于骨干網路由器。Diffserv和Intserv相結合為WAN提供全局的分級服務方案將是很好的選擇。VoIP網絡中為了獲得較好的QoS效果,WAN適合于采用區分型業務模型,而LAN適合Intserv和DiffServ模型的混合形式。在實現Intserv和DiffServ的互通中,需要解決RSVP在DiffServ域中如何進行處理,以及Intserv支持的業務與DiffServ支持的PHB(Per-Hop-Behavior)之間的映射這兩個主要問題。IETF建議了兩種互通方式來保證端到端的QoS。一種方法是將綜合服務覆蓋在DiffServ網上,RSVP信令完全透明地通過;另外一種方法是簡單的并行處理,即DiffServ域參與RSVP的協議處理:采取一些策略決定哪些包用RSVP,哪些用DiffServ處理[7]。
2、VoWLAN的QoS機制
Intserv和DifferServ是針對有線傳輸提出的,而VoWLAN則利用無線傳輸,故上述的QoS機制不能直接應用于VoWLAN的Qos中,主要有兩個原因:
(1)在無線傳輸中,串擾和多徑傳播將導致衰落和色散,因此無線網絡具有數據傳輸率低而誤碼率高的特點;而WLAN等為了保證靈活性和兼容性,協議標準一般只制訂MAC層和PHY層規范,從而造成網絡上層的QoS與無線鏈路層的分離,最終QoS無法得到充分利用。
(2)隨著無線接入技術的發展,異質網絡的應用將越來越普及,各種應用一般會經過無線接入。在這種情況下,僅依靠傳統的有線網絡QoS機制已經無法提供端到端的服務質量保障,迫切需要一種能夠針對無線信道的特點,在無線鏈路層媒體訪問控制(MAC)子層提供網絡業務的區分、優先級控制、資源分配等的QoS控制和保障,從而對無線網絡和有線網絡的QoS進行整體規劃[8]。
普通的802.11無線局域網MAC層有兩種通訊方式:即分布式協同方式(DCF,Distributed Coordination Function)和點協同方式(PCF,Point Coordination Function)。其中,PCF在標準規范中定位為可選擇實現的協議機制,而DCF為強制要求實現的協議機制。PCF和DCF可以共同工作于同一個系統中。PCF機制下,網絡中各個節點由一個中心控制節點采用輪詢的方式統一為其調度安排信道接入占用,因此通常需要有網絡基礎設施的支持(如Access Point,AP)。。DCF是一種以CSMA/CA為基礎的分布式信道接入控制機制,在這種機制下,各個節點以隨機方式競爭接入信道,無需網絡基礎設施,因此也被廣泛應用于無中心結構的無線自組織網絡中。PCF設計的目的是用于服務網絡中具有時間敏感特性的多媒體實時業務,如語音、視頻等業務,利用PCF可以為這類業務流的傳輸提供信道資源預留,保障其數據傳輸的及時性。盡管如此,PCF存在無法高效利用信道資源,QoS支持能力非常有限,工程實現較為復雜等諸多缺點。因此,在現如今的IEEE 802.11相關產品中PCF很少被采用。
隨著WLAN的快速發展,各種新應用的出現對網絡的QoS支持能力提出了更高的要求,如何使得業務傳輸的QoS質量得到保障等問題越來越突出。為了適應這一發展的需要,IEEE在已有IEEE 802.11標準的基礎上進一步制定了增強QoS支持的MAC層規范,即IEEE 802.11e標準。其QoS增強部分主要體現在于,IEEE 802.11e根據業務類型的不同進行了優先級的區分,并通過引入多種信道接入區分服務機制支持不同優先級的服務質量要求。IEEE 802.1le標準草案于2005年發布,隨后在IEEE 802.11-2007正式標準規范中被歸檔合并取代[11]。
IEEE 802.11的QoS增強MAC包括有HCCA(Hybrid Controlled Channel Access)控制信道接入和EDCA(Enhanced Distributed Channel Access)增強分布式信道接入兩種信道接入機制,分別對應為PCF和DCF的增強擴展。同PCF一樣,HCCA也通過輪詢的方式為各個節點調度安排信道的接入占用。HCCA實現了無競爭的保證服務,但是實現太過復雜,而且犧牲了無線網絡分布式的優點。
EDCA是802.11e為實現更好的服務質量而提出的基于優先級的信道接入機制,它定義了四種基于IEEE 802.11的訪問類型(Access Category,AC)即:語音Voice、視頻Video、盡力而為Best Effort和背景流Background,使用8種用戶優先級(UP,User Priority)來接入無線媒體,這里的用戶指的是上層的業務,為不同的業務類型提供不同的業務等級,使得那些實時業務較高的優先級優先接入信道。8種用戶優先級(UP)和四種訪問類型(AC)的映射規則為:一個UP對應一個AC;每個AC包含兩個UP;在同一個AC中優先級高的UP優先接入信道,詳見下表[9]。

表2 EDCA的業務類別與AC的映射
雖然IEEE802.11e已經定義了MAC層的QoS標準,可是我們還是需要有機制去監督和拒絕不同類別的流量來來保證QoS機制的有效(Traffic Category)。接納控制(Admission Control)在基于802.11標準的WLAN網絡的QoS機制中其中至關重要的作用[10]。接納控制是用來控制業務是否能夠接入信道的機制。接納控制是在保證已接納業務的QoS性能不下降的前提下,判斷是否允許接入新的業務,使得信道的利用率最大化。為了防止網絡負載超出其承受能力以及保護已有的數據流的傳輸,使用接納控制機制控制網絡負載保證QoS性能是有必要的。接納控制通常取決于調度算法、可用信道容量、鏈路狀態、重傳限制以及給定業務流的調度需求。
接納控制:接納控制可以分為兩大類,即基于測量的接納控制和基于模型的接納控制。基于測量的機制根據對當前網絡狀態的測量,如吞吐量、時延的測量等,來決定是否接納新業務。如文獻提出的虛擬MAC算法[12],通過虛擬MAC幀監測信道,而且根據虛擬幀的測量來估算本地服務情況,如吞吐量和時延,然后再做出接納決定。而基于模型的機制根據建立的模型計算模型的性能度量,然后再做出決定。
由于WLAN網絡是一種開放式的網絡結構體系,要在現有網絡條件下實現端到端的有保障QoS,就必須找到一種VoWLAN的有效機制。每個網域都應該執行一種相應的服務等級約定以保證實時語音數據能以期望的質量傳輸。對于核電站而言僅從QoS的角度分析,基于測量的接納控制方式更能保證服務質量。但目前接納控制防止在業內還處于理論研究階段,現存的幾種保障Qos的方式也各有優缺點,導致很難在一個大范圍網域內只應用一種機制來保障QoS的標準。所以,應用綜合的QoS解決方案是現在解決核電站QoS問題的一種方式,同時繼續探索研究更進一步的QoS機制也是確保核電站無線通信服務質量的研究方向。
參考文獻
[1]孟川杰,黃宏光.VoIP原理及其在無線局域網中的QoS保障[J].中國測試技術,2006,5.
[2]葛倫躍,吳其林.IEEE802.11e無線局域網中VoIP容量分析與改進[J].計算機工程與應用,2011,47(18).
[3]張登銀,孫精科.VolP技術分析與系統設計[M].北京:人民郵電出版社,2003.
[4]http://baike.baidu.com[EB/OL].
[5]徐山峰.基于SIP協議的VoIP系統的QoS機制的研究[J].現代電子技術,2010,9.
[6]Abderrahmane Lakas and Mohamed Boulmalf.Study of the Effect of Mobility Handover on VoIP over WLAN[J].IEEE 2006.
[7]姚玉坤,劉合武.IntServ與DiffServ在VoIP QoS中的應用分析[J].計算機與數字工程,2007,4.
[8]Taekyu Kim,Seungbeom Lee and Sin-Chong Park.Call Admission Control Based on Adaptive Physical Rate for EDCA in IEEE 802.11e WLAN System[J].IEEE CCNC 2008.
[9]Mohamed Khedr.Evaluation of SIP-based VOIP in Heterogeneous Networks[J].
[10]Fakhar Uddin Ahmed .QoS and Admission Controller in IEEE 802.11e WLAN,4th International Conference on Intelligent Systems[J].Modeling and Simulation,2013.
[11]IEEE 802.11-2007.
[12]M.Barry,A.T.Campell,and A.Veres.Distributed Control Algorithms for Service Differentiation in Wireless Packet Networks[C].Proc.IEEE INFOCOM 2001.
Research on QoS Mechanism of Wireless Communication System in Nuclear Power Stations
Jing Yi Chen Hang
(Shanghai Nuclear Engineering Research & Design Institute Shanghai 200233)
Abstrac With the development of the technologies including nuclear plant,wireless communications and EMC recently,it is emerging trend that the wireless communication systems based on WLAN have been deployed in the nuclear plant .VoWLAN,that is Voice over WLAN,is the communication technology that the voice is transmitted over IP network,VoWLAN is the extensions and updates over VoIP,makes that wireless,offers the users more convenience on voice conversations.QoS is necessary for the guarantee of the transmitting system of IP networks.This article introduce the key technologies of VoWLAN and the influence factors of QoS,discussed the mechanism and improving methods of QoS,such as delay,jitter,packet loss.
KeywordsVoIPWLANQoSSIP
中圖分類號TL4;TN926+.3
文獻標識碼A
文章編號160509-7268
作者簡介
景弋,男,工程師,華東理工大學在職研究生;2005年正式加入上海核工程研究設計院,主要從事核電廠實物保護、通信、火災探測及報警系統設計和民用弱電系統設計;作為主要設計人員或負責人參與過秦山一期、秦山三期、巴基斯坦C2/C3/C4、三門、海陽、彭澤、咸寧、桃花江、陸豐、紅沿河、示范工程等核電項目,具有連續1年以上的現場工作經驗;“核盾”實物保護集成管理平臺主要開發人員之一;在職期間獲得過4項科技成果獎及4項專利等。
陳航,男,高級工程師,上海交大研究生;1998年正式加入上海核工程研究設計院,高級工程師,主要從事核電廠通信、火災探測及報警系統及實物保護系統設計工作;參與巴基斯坦C2/C3/C4項目、秦山一期改造設計;參與三代核電依托項目的招投標工作,參與三代核電依托項目的工程設計和管理工作。